It is quick, easy, and delicious. You can have a summer peach pie any time of year.
Ingredients:
9-10 pounds peaches
2 teaspoons Fruit Fresh
3 1/2 cups sugar
1/2 cup plus 3 Tablespoons quick cooking tapioca
1/4 cup lemon juice
1 teaspoon salt
Directions:
To peel peaches, first bring a pot of water to a boil. Using a paring knife, score the peaches with an X in the the blossom end of the skin only. Gently drop the peaches in the boiling water for approximately 30-60 seconds. Using a slotted spoon, remove the peaches and place them in iced water for a minute or so. The skins should slip off easily. If not, place back into the boiling water for another 30seconds.
Peel, remove the pit, and discard. Slice the peaches and put them in a bowl. Add lemon juice. Mix. Mix Fruit Fresh, sugar, tapioca and salt together, add to peaches, mixing well.
Line 4 pie pans with heavy foil, placing plastic wrap across in one direction and then turn the pan 1/4 turn and put another piece of plastic wrap across in the other direction. Make sure they are long enough to cover the filling. Divide evenly (about 4-5 cups) per pan. Loosely fold wrap over filling, then the foil, leaving it in the pan and freeze until firm. When filling is frozen solid, remove from pans and wrap tightly. Put into gallon ziploc freezer bags and label. Return to freezer until ready to use.
On Pie Baking Day:
Ingredients:
2 nine-inch pie crusts (for bottom and top)
1/2 stick (4 tablespoons) butter
1 teaspoon cinnamon or nutmeg
For each pie, simply place frozen pie filling in pie shell, dot with butter and sprinkle with cinnamon or nutmeg. Top pie with an additional pastry crust, seal well, brush with a little milk and sprinkle with a bit of sugar. Bake for 50-60 minutes in a preheated 375 degree oven.
